Summary

In this episode of Heat Exchanger, the hosts and guests discuss various aspects of time attack racing, with a focus on recent events at Mid-Ohio. They delve into the importance of communication among drivers, the management of outlap speeds, and the role of corner workers in ensuring safety on track. The conversation also addresses the challenges of obtaining time attack licenses and the necessity of a collaborative approach to enhance the racing community. Overall, the episode emphasizes the importance of learning from mistakes and fostering a supportive environment for all competitors. The conversation explores the intricacies of driver vetting, safety education, and community feedback within the time attack racing scene. It highlights the challenges faced by organizers in maintaining high standards for drivers while addressing concerns about event costs and scheduling. The discussion emphasizes the importance of communication, transparency, and the shared responsibility of both drivers and organizers in fostering a safe and enjoyable racing environment. Personal reflections from participants underscore the emotional investment and commitment to improvement within the community.
